Transaction ad3ff90bdd06ca4dfe9663153ca953ac616238e54448fc30c4d34a70f56b2798
1 Input
2 Outputs
- ad3ff90bdd06ca4dfe9663153ca953ac616238e54448fc30c4d34a70f56b2798:0
- ad3ff90bdd06ca4dfe9663153ca953ac616238e54448fc30c4d34a70f56b2798:1
value 341679
address 36QpR79u4TcFEYZoChxF1t6EixKmRWMkXr
value 1599822
address 18RQgbQvYSxeDJanySPZ8jwUhJUwkkRjRr